Your sales rep calls your factory and asks your chief engineer and your senior marketing manager to fly to Saint Louis for a customer meeting; a vice president asks to be taken in on an account that "looks interesting"; and suddenly, whether you know it or not, you're team selling. But as team selling guru Steve Waterhouse explains in "The Team Selling Solution, team selling is more than just bringing a VP along on a sales call or introducing the client to your chief engineer. In this completely practical and accessible guide, Waterhouse shares the techniques he developed to create world-class sales teams for such leading organizations as AT&T, IBM, Xerox, Wyeth-Ayerst, Coca-Cola, and many others. Drawing upon this vast experience, he demonstrates the power of team selling to cut costs and increase sales, boost revenue per customer, and promote customer satisfaction. What follows is a step-by-step tutorial on how to build, organize, lead, and contribute to a winning sales team. Illustrating his points with enlightening vignettes drawn from a wide variety of industries, Waterhouse shows team leaders and members how to conduct a well-planned, coordinated effort to satisfy the needs of a group of customer decision makers--in other words, how to win a complex sale. On the investment playing field, there is perhaps no game more exciting than short selling. With the right moves, it can yield high returns; one misstep, however, can have disastrous consequences. Despite the risk, a growing number of players are anteing up, sparked in part by success stories such as that of George Soros and the billions he netted by short selling the British pound. In The Art of Short Selling, Kathryn Staley, an expert in the field, examines the essentials of this important investment vehicle, providing a comprehensive game plan with which you can effectively play - and win - the short selling game. Whether used as a means of hedging bets, decreasing the volatility of total returns, or improving returns, short selling must be handled with care - and with the right know-how. As Staley points out, "Short selling is not for the faint of heart. If a stock moves against the position holder, the effect on a portfolio and net worth can be devastating. Investors need to understand the impact on their accounts as well as the consequences of getting bought in before they indulge in short selling". Sell-side analyst - A sell-side analyst works for a brokerage firm or an investment bank. They spend their time evaluating companies for future earnings growth, and place recommendations on stocks as "buy", "sell", "hold", etc.

Sell (professional wrestling) - In professional wrestling, the sell is the element of making the action appear to be at least somewhat realistic to the crowd, or at least the marks within the crowd. In other words, it has to do with the acting necessary to sell the storyline.

Buy or Sell (The Price is Right pricing game) - Buy or Sell is a pricing game on the American television game show, "The Price is Right." It is played for three four-digit prize, each valued between $1,000 and $3,000; along with a cash bonus.

John Sell Cotman - John Sell Cotman (1782 - 1842) was a painter of the Norwich school and an associate of John Crome. He was born in Norwich and worked mainly in watercolour, but also produced architectural engravings.

Overstocks Selling - Overstocks Selling Cross-selling - Cross-selling is the strategy of selling other products to a customer who has already purchased (or signalled their intention to purchase) a product from the vendor. Cross-selling is designed to increase the customer's reliance on the company and decrease the likelihood of the customer switching to a competitor.
